  • Each color on the visible light spectrum has unique wavelengths. On one end of the spectrum, red has long, stretched-out wavelengths, while the other end is violet, which has short wavelengths that occur more frequently. So, if we look at a red apple, all the colors with shorter wavelengths, such as violet, blue, and green, will be absorbed while red, which has the longest wavelengths, will reflect off the object. Thus, the apple will appear red to us. - Source: Internet

  • Since blue and gray are both cool colors, the combo can make interior spaces feel cold and uninviting in a hurry; unless, of course, you pair the duo with a warmer accent, such as wood. In this bathroom by Raili Clasen, light wood cabinets sandwich a light gray floating sink. Blue details — like the flooring, faucet, and even the trim on the pendant light — add an unexpected and fun pop to an otherwise serious color scheme, as well as complement the blue undertones that are oftentimes found in gray. “In this case, we used blue as our accent color because it does not clash with the solid gray.” explains Clasen. - Source: Internet

  • People often confuse the CMYK color model for being similar to RGB. CMYK is a form of subtractive mixing that’s used for printer ink. The primary colors on the CMYK color model are cyan, magenta, and yellow, while the secondary colors are red, green, and blue. Even though those are the same but opposite colors of RGB, the two models are very different. Colors like black, gray, and brown exist in CMYK even though they don’t exist in RGB. - Source: Internet

  • The color wheel can be a helpful tool for determining what colors go with navy blue. For a complementary color scheme, look to blue’s opposite on the wheel: orange. The fiery hue introduces warmth that balances the cool depth of navy blue. Establish a bold, colorful look with a medium-tone shade of orange, such as tangerine or papaya, that will stand up well against its dark counterpart. Lighter shades like coral or cantaloupe make beautiful accent colors in coastal-style rooms. - Source: Internet

  • ‘As versatile as grey is, it is important to consider undertones when pairing it with another shade’ says Richard. ‘Cool greys are best paired with cooler colour schemes, such as blue, green, and light purple, while warm greys better complement reds, oranges, and yellows. For fans of the monochrome look, incorporate different shades of grey, alongside white and black, to create depth and visual interest.’ - Source: Internet

  • Nothing will happen if you try to mix blue and gray lights because there’s no such thing as gray light. Black is the absence of detectable light, and gray is just a lighter version of black. That’s why you won’t find gray anywhere on the visible light spectrum or the RGB color model, which is a form of additive mixing used for lights and digital displays. - Source: Internet
